Brain Control of Appetite and Body Weight

from Naked Scientists, In Short Special Editions Podcast · host The Naked Scientists

This month, Dr Lora Heisler discusses the brain mechanisms controlling our appetite and subsequent body weight. She explores the many drivers behind hunger and appetite control and how these differ from person to person as well as how obesity can be avoided by increasing our energy expenditure...
